Opportunity description
This Request For Information (RFI) is intended solely for information gathering. Responses are voluntary and will not be used to evaluate or prequalify respondents for any future procurement actions or timber sales.This RFI is for market research only. It does not constitute a solicitation, does not commit the Government to issue a future solicitation, and does not obligate the Government to award any contract or timber sale. The U.S. Forest Service is issuing this RFI to gather market insights from timber purchasers, forest product companies, wood processors, biomass users, and other forest-related businesses operating in or near Colorado. The information provided will help the Forest Service evaluate current and emerging market needs, assess interest in different contract structures, and plan future offerings that support forest health, economic development, and long-term stewardship. Scope: National Forests in Colorado This RFI applies to potential timber offerings and contract opportunities across the following National Forests located in the State of Colorado: � Arapaho & Roosevelt National Forests � Grand Mesa, Uncompahgre & Gunnison National Forests (GMUG) � Pike & San Isabel National Forests � Rio Grande National Forest � San Juan National Forest � White River National Forest � Routt National Forest Requested Information Respondents are encouraged to provide detailed information in the following areas: Forest Products of Interest � Species and product types you are interested in purchasing (e.g., sawtimber, pulpwood, biomass, posts and poles, specialty products). � Desired product specifications (diameter, length, quality, form, volume per unit). � Anticipated future product needs or market trends affecting your operations in Colorado. Desired Quantities � Approximate annual volume needs by product type. � Minimum and maximum volume thresholds. � Variability or flexibility in volume depending on market conditions. Contract Length and Structure � Preferred contract durations (short-term, multi-year, long-term, fixed-term). � Operational or business advantages supporting longer-term contracts on National Forest lands. � Volume levels or conditions that justify long-term commitments. Short-Term vs. Long-Term Needs � Immediate forest product needs (1�3 years). � Longer-term projections (3�10 years). � Expected changes in production capacity, mill capabilities, product mix, or equipment. Service Contracts vs. Traditional Timber Sale Contracts � Level of interest in service contracts (e.g., thinning-by-the-acre, biomass removal, stewardship work). � Interest in contracts combining service work with product removal (e.g., IRSC, IRTC). � Operational, financial, or administrative considerations affecting contract preference. � Incentives or conditions that would increase participation in service contracts. Operational Considerations � Planned investments in facilities, equipment, or workforce dependent on predictable forest product availability. � Preferred geographic areas or specific National Forests where your business can operate most efficiently. � Seasonal constraints, logistical challenges, haul route considerations, or mill delivery requirements. Additional Feedback � Suggestions for strengthening forest product markets in Colorado. � Recommended improvements to contract flexibility, timelines, or administrative processes. � Any other information to help the Forest Service better align timber offerings with industry needs. Please include the following information in your response: Company name Primary business contact Location of operations Summary of current processing capabilities Responses to requested information Responses are welcomed through December 1, 2026, Please submit responses electronically to the points of contact listed below.
